HOT STATUS is a kind of techno-thriller involving a now defunct air defense missile system called Nike Hercules. I worked as a radar mechanic at one of the many US sites in the late 60s. (Told you it was defunct.) The site was out on Sandy Hook, New Jersey, that appendix-shaped spit of sand that's aimed at the heart of Manhattan.
The sites in Continental US were all dismantled in the early 1970s, about the time the World Trade Center buildings were going up. If the 9/11 attacks had taken place thirty years earlier, could we have shot down at least one of those planes? I don't know for sure, but the guy headed for the South Tower passed over a plethora of air defense sites in Northern New Jersey on his way to the target.
And I have to tell you, we routinely checked our radars by locking up on commercial airliners...
